Little Icon India Grand Finale Concluded In Bangalore Central Bannergatta Road
On a breezy winter evening, Grand Finale of Little Icon India took place in Bangalore Central Bannergatta Road. As they say, the greatest gifts you can give children are to roots of responsibility and...
Recent Comments